Email templates are a game-changer for businesses looking to streamline their communication efforts. Whether you’re sending out a newsletter, a professional email, or a marketing campaign, having a well-designed template can make all the difference.
When it comes to creating an email template, there are a few key things to keep in mind. First and foremost, you want to make sure that your template is responsive and looks great on any device. This means using a layout that adapts to different screen sizes and resolutions.
Another important factor to consider is the design of your template. A clean, professional design will help to establish credibility with your audience and make your emails more visually appealing. Don’t be afraid to get creative with colors, fonts, and imagery to make your template stand out.
If you’re new to email template design, there are plenty of resources available to help you get started. From online tutorials to template libraries, you can find plenty of inspiration and guidance to create a template that fits your needs.
